在ASP中的票证年龄是指在ASP.NET中用于验证和管理用户身份的一种机制。票证年龄是指票证(也称为身份验证票证)的有效期限,即票证在服务器上保持有效的时间。
票证年龄的设置可以通过配置文件或代码来实现。一般情况下,票证年龄可以设置为一个固定的时间段,例如10分钟、1小时或1天。当用户成功登录后,服务器会颁发一个票证给用户,并将该票证存储在客户端的Cookie中或通过其他方式传递给客户端。客户端在每次请求服务器时都会携带该票证,服务器会根据票证的有效期限来判断用户的身份是否有效。
票证年龄的设置可以根据具体的业务需求进行调整。较短的票证年龄可以提高安全性,因为用户需要更频繁地重新登录以获取新的票证。然而,较短的票证年龄也会增加用户的操作负担。较长的票证年龄可以提高用户的便利性,但也增加了安全风险,因为票证可能会被盗用或滥用。
ASP.NET提供了一些相关的类和方法来管理票证年龄,例如FormsAuthentication类和Ticket类。开发人员可以使用这些类来创建、验证和更新票证,并设置票证的年龄。
在腾讯云的产品中,与票证年龄相关的产品包括腾讯云的身份认证服务(CAM)和访问管理(IAM)服务。CAM提供了身份验证和访问控制的功能,可以帮助开发人员管理用户的身份和权限。IAM服务则提供了更细粒度的访问控制,可以根据用户的身份和角色来限制其对资源的访问权限。
更多关于腾讯云CAM和IAM服务的信息,可以参考以下链接:
领取专属 10元无门槛券
手把手带您无忧上云